Output 7c62b56b1ec9fa063fb438fcef00a400d77e4544b126d43db560d09ef426283a:0

value
660268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 248dabf06d5f1cf5efcfd566f7af7cc4e6f33bd1 OP_EQUAL
address
352Hxy5CboTgWAsc4AyrLj833xSo82js8p
transaction
7c62b56b1ec9fa063fb438fcef00a400d77e4544b126d43db560d09ef426283a
spent
true